Modified Retroperitoneoscope Retroperitoneal Lymph Node Dissection for a Non-seminomatous Testicular Tumour- a Video Vignette

Retroperitoneal lymph node dissection is the main treatment strategy for non-seminomatous testicular tumour1, which could be performed by transperitoneal laparoscopy or retroperitoneal laparoscopy. Compared with transperitoneal laparoscopy, the retroperitoneal approach has an advantage of minimally invasion2, while it has not been widely used. The main reason may be that the retroperitoneal approach is more complex and lack of standard steps. In this video, we describe an modified technique which could help to better understand and carry out the operation.
